| | |
| | | return list;
|
| | | }
|
| | |
|
| | | //机房命令操作设备时的cmd和ack校验
|
| | | public boolean sendCmdToFBS9100Dev(int cmd,int dev_id)
|
| | | //机房命令操作设备时的cmd和ack校验 test_type -->默认启动测试的类型
|
| | | public boolean sendCmdToFBS9100Dev(int cmd,int test_type,int dev_id)
|
| | | {
|
| | | int m_cmd = cmd;
|
| | | int m_cmd_ack = cmd;
|
| | |
| | | case FBS9100_ComBase.CMd_SetIp_Per: m_cmd_ack = FBS9100_ComBase.CMd_SetIpAck; break;
|
| | | default: return false;
|
| | | }
|
| | | String sql_end = "";
|
| | | if(test_type > 0 && cmd == FBS9100_ComBase.CMD_Start){ //启动测试时未点击设定参数按钮,会出现启动内阻测试bug修复
|
| | | sql_end = ",TestCmd="+test_type;
|
| | | }
|
| | | boolean res_exe = false;
|
| | | String sql = "UPDATE db_ram_db.tb_fbs9100_setparam SET "
|
| | | + " op_cmd=? "
|
| | | + " op_cmd=? " + sql_end
|
| | | + " WHERE dev_id=? ";
|
| | | Boolean bl=DAOHelper.executeUpdate(DBUtil.getConn(), sql, new Object[]{m_cmd,dev_id});
|
| | | if(true == bl)
|